Follow Us! Like Our Page!

Full Stack Java Development Lead

Full Stack Java Development Lead

Reference No. MIS-IE-P1-3003

PURPOSE: Mustimuhw Information Solutions Inc. (MIS) invites resume applications for a Full Stack Java Development Lead. Reporting to the Program Director this is a unique and exciting opportunity to lead the development team in a multi-year program to create the Indigenous Digital Health Ecosystem (IDHE): (https://www.digitalsupercluster.ca/projects/indigenous-digital-health-ecosystem).

As Development Lead you will work closely with key business and technical stakeholders from MIS and Consortium members. You will play a central role in delivering a “born in the cloud”, culturally aligned digital platform and suite of integrated applications, to create highly differentiated software solutions that better meet the unique needs of First Nation communities. You will also be central to refining the Agile and DevOps processes once the IDHE is in production and will lead the development team to deliver refinements and future releases of the platform.

If you like to collaborate, share, and work in a diverse, supportive, and motivated environment and want to make a real and lasting difference this could be the opportunity you have been waiting for. If you have extensive Java development and team lead expertise and creating something new from the ground up excites you we would love to hear from you.

RESPONSIBILITIES:

  • Develop enterprise scale web applications using Java and React frameworks.
  • Develop front end web User Interfaces as outlined in the User Experience design standards and related mock-ups.
  • Perform impact analysis, design and develop enhancements, bug fixes and other software releases.
  • Work closely with business, partner, and technical representatives to ensure technical designs and software satisfy customer and non-functional requirements, incl integrations with other systems.
  • Work closely with the Product Owner and Solution Architect to understand and correctly interpret user stories and requirements.
  • Work with the Solution Architect to complete analysis and design of enterprise scale web application/s. Contribute to identification of solution options to meet requirements and when required research and evaluate alternative approaches / solutions and make recommendations.
  • Contribute to project, test, and deployment planning.
  • Write robust, well-structured, well commented, maintainable, efficient, unit tested code.
  • Review application code and provide feedback as necessary to the development team.
  • Raise relevant technical risks and issues.
  • Assist the Solution Architect to manage tasks for the development team.
  • Follow and reinforce MIS’ Agile development methodology
  • Apply MIS’ Agile development methodology.
  • Participate in daily scrums and peer code reviews.
  • Actively contribute to Sprint Planning and Reviews.
  • Help groom user stories.
  • Bring agile software development best practices to the team and coach peer developers on their application. o Support and help MIS mature its Agile and DevOps processes by contributing to and implementing best practice development processes such as CI / CD.

PREREQUISITES:

  • Proven ability to uphold confidentiality as it relates to the role and department
  • Self-directed self-starter
  • Sharing mindset
  • Demonstrated ability to work independently as well collaboratively and positively with the other team members (consultants, employees, partner organizations) regardless of their role
  • Have a sense of urgency to deliver outcomes and meet deadlines
  • Clear English communication skills
  • BSc Computer Science or equivalent
  • A current Criminal Record Check (CRC) may be required

QUALIFICATIONS AND EXPERIENCE:

  • 8+ years of experience:
  • in full-stack, enterprise level Java application development, including Front End and Back End design, development, testing and implementation;
  • in Single Page Application (SPA) development using React libraries and concepts;
  • developing concurrent, parallel, and distributed cloud-based software solutions;
  • in responsive Front End UI frameworks and libraries such as ReactJS;
  • in HTML5 (and latest evolution of CSS/SASS);
  • in REST service-oriented architectures;
  • in UI libraries such as Material UI and Bootstrap; and
  • with relational databases such as MySQL, PostgreSQL or Oracle.
  • Highly proficient in normalized relational database design.
  • Demonstrated experience:
  • with Agile Scrum methodology, story point estimation and Agile task management tools such as Jira;
  • with test driven development methods;
  • with software testing frameworks (unit, on-regression, user acceptance);
  • meeting quoted time estimates to develop, test and implement software;
  • with build automation tools such as Gradle or Maven;
  • Git Source Version Control;
  • developing secure code following OWASP best practices;
  • developing and/or consuming REST API / services; and
  • with Java performance analysis and tuning.

VALUE-ADDED QUALIFICATIONS AND EXPERIENCE:

  • Hands on experience with Linux or Unix environments, and Shell scripting.
  • Amazon Web Services (AWS) cloud hosting and knowledge of AWS development, testing and automation processes and tools.
  • Health Care industry experience, in particular Electronic Medical Records systems.
  • Experience developing systems or providing services to First Nations or Indigenous communities.

HOW TO APPLY: Interested applicants are invited to submit a current resume and cover letter with up to three references to [email protected] This posting will stay open until filled. Interviews will be scheduled on a weekly or as needed basis for eligible applicants. Please include the Reference # in the subject line of your email.

Reference No. MIS-IE-P1-3003

Mustimuhw Information Solutions Inc. (MIS)

Email: [email protected]

Website: https://www.mustimuhw.com

Pursuant to section 41 of the BC Human Rights Code, preference may be given to applicants of Indigenous ancestry. We thank all applicants in advance, but only shortlisted candidates will be contacted.

 412 total views,  2 views today

NationTalk Partners & Sponsors Learn More